About Merle Aguillera

During the Siege of Veyl Marsh, when plague-ridden refugees flooded the crumbling temple gates and every herb had been burned or spoiled, Merle didn’t reach for incantation scrolls, she pressed her palms to damp earth and coaxed bioluminescent moss from cracked stone, its glow stabilizing fevers and its spores purifying stagnant air. That night, she wove healing sigils not into skin or cloth, but into the very humidity, turning breath itself into a salve. Her magic refuses abstraction: it grows, decays, migrates, and remembers, rooted in fungal networks, tidal rhythms, and the quiet metabolism of decay-and-renewal. She carries no staff, only a chipped ceramic vial filled with river silt from three continents, each layer holding a different resonance. When she hums, nearby lichens pulse faintly in time. Her gentleness isn’t passive, it’s the stillness before mycelium breaches concrete, patient and inevitable.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why does Merle’s magic require physical contact with organic matter?
Her magic operates through symbiotic resonance, not command. It reads cellular memory in living or recently living tissue—wood grain, bone marrow, even dried kelp—to calibrate dosage and duration. Without that anchor, spells destabilize into uncontrolled growth or premature dissolution.
Is Merle affiliated with any formal magical academy or temple order?
She was expelled from the Celestine Conclave at seventeen for replacing their sterile healing glyphs with wild-spore matrices that 'encouraged infection as part of recovery.' She now trains apprentices in abandoned root cellars and tidal caves, where magic must negotiate with environment—not dominate it.
What limits Merle’s ability to heal chronic conditions like soul-fraying or echo-sickness?
Her craft treats imbalance, not absence. Soul-fraying requires reintegration, not repair—so she guides patients through ritual composting of worn talismans and replanting memories in shared soil. Echo-sickness resists her methods entirely; she refers those cases to sound-weavers who work in harmonic frequencies, not biological ones.
Does Merle’s magic leave visible traces on those she heals?
Yes—temporary epidermal patterns resembling lichen colonies appear for 3–11 days, shifting subtly with the patient’s hydration and circadian rhythm. These aren’t scars but biofeedback markers; Merle reads them like tide charts to adjust follow-up care.
